A full kitchen remodel can be an expensive undertaking, but it doesn't need to be. You can create a new kitchen using your old kitchen cabinets and a little designer know how.
There's no need to replace old kitchen cabinets when you can save a fortune by simply refurbishing the old ones. For those of you that would like to replace your oak cabinets with handsome espresso finished cabinets, you can simply paint them a dark espresso. Yes, wood lovers, oak can be painted!
To start, remove all the doors and hardware. Then, clean each cabinet, and give them a light sanding with a fine grit paper. Next, dust the doors with tact cloth and then get ready to paint. I prefer to roll on the pain to avoid brush marks.
As for kitchen cabinet frames, these can be reconfigured to add movement to any kitchen. In the last few years, we've started to see even the most basic of kitchen cabinets placed in a position other than a straight line. A room looks larger when cabinets are raised and lowered according to the wall and their location within the kitchen. To raise and lower existing cabinets, attach cabinet frames to the wall with screws and bolts which can be easily removed. You may want to leave one or two boxes open for glass and dish shelving space.
You can paint the bottom cabinets as well as re-hang all the doors and put on new handles and pulls. The one area where you should spend a little money is on a new counter top - granite, solid surface or diamond finish granite which looks a lot like laminate. Remember that it typically will take a few weeks to get a new countertop, so order in a timely manner. With the exception of the counter top, you can have a completely new kitchen in minimal time and at a minimum cost.
